A patient with type 1 diabetes is prescribed a sliding scale insulin regimen using regular insulin before meals. The sliding scale is as follows: Blood glucose 150-199 mg/dL: 2 units Blood glucose 200-249 mg/dL: 4 units Blood glucose 250-299 mg/dL: 6 units Blood glucose 300-349 mg/dL: 8 units Blood glucose >350 mg/dL: Call provider The patient's blood glucose before lunch is 278 mg/dL. The patient is also prescribed 0.1 units/kg of insulin glargine (Lantus) once daily. The patient weighs 70 kg. How many total units of insulin should the nurse administer at this time? Explanation & Rationale
Calculation: Determine the regular insulin dose based on the sliding scale. The patient's blood glucose before lunch is 278 mg/dL. According to the sliding scale: Blood glucose 250-299 mg/dL: 6 units Therefore, the regular insulin dose is 6 units. Calculate the insulin glargine (Lantus) dose. Client weight = 70 kg. Prescription for insulin glargine = 0.1 units/kg once daily. Insulin glargine dose = 0.1 units/kg × 70 kg = 7 units. Calculate the total units of insulin to administer. Total units = Regular insulin units + Insulin glargine units Total units = 6 units + 7 units = 13 units.
